How many days do you need in Cebu?
Three full days covers the headline sights without sprinting: one anchor experience each morning, an unhurried afternoon in a single neighborhood, then a food or nightlife booking in the evening. Five days lets you add a day trip outside the city.

How does the Outty Ranking work?
Every experience in Cebu gets a single 0 to 100 score built from traveler sentiment, the depth of review evidence, recent booking momentum, price fairness against comparable options in the same city, operator standing and cancellation flexibility. Scores are benchmarked within Cebu so a strong local option is not buried by global volume, and anything at 90 or above joins the Outty 90+ Club.
